Print PDFS without fonts embedded (for the USPTO)

I need to print PDF files which can be downloaded in the PTO we, and so they are compatible, they must not have embedded fonts. I use the XI of Acrobat Distiller with the configuration file downloaded directly from the website of PTO http://www.uspto.gov/ebc/portal/efs/uspto.joboptions, but the fonts are always be included. Is it possible to get the PDF Distiller to not embed fonts?

The file, .joboptions your assignment pointing to very precisely the requests that all fonts are embedded, subset!

So if you use these joboptions to produce PDFS, you get exactly what the joboptions call for.

If somewhere on the US Patent and Trademark Office site Web tells you not to embed the fonts and then provides these joboptions, while they give contradictory information you!

However, the search of this Web site, I found instructions for the creation of PDFs as in EFS-Web PDF guidelines> and the PDF attachment from the Web site.

In fact, the US Patent and Trademark Office has absolutely need that embed you all fonts.

    A little history on how standard sRGB was created. It is a standard, including more things, but above all defining an abstract color space. It was created sometime after that the market was already flooded with computer monitors, and the creation of ideal sRGB color space was based on an average PC monitor display capabilities over time. After that the manufacturers used this standard sRGB as a target to create monitors.

  • Acrobat SDK vs PDF Library SDK (especially for the AcroForms)

    Hi all

    I would like to develop an application for reading and setting the value within the AcroForm and a setting AcroForm shaped. For this purpose, I would use some of the existing API methods. I have a few questions:

    1) what are the differences of the SDK Acrobat and PDF Library SDK kit? (see the Documentation of the SDK Acrobat DC)

    Among others: kit SDK Acrobat and PDF Library SDK use the same PDF Library API? Just a different subset of it? What licensing and the pricing? Is my application above suggested a Library Application called "PDF"? What Acrobat Forms API - it is part of the extended for plug-in API but is not part of the PDF Library API?

    (2) what steps can I for the formatting and setting/read the value of an AcroForm?

    Can I use the two SDKs for this? (it seems that Yes, see Adobe PDF Library SDK |) Adobe Developer Connection) what are the advantages/disadvantages? What API methods come from? (Acrobat Forms API?)

    Thanks for all the info on these points

    The PDFLibrary SDK is a subset of the Acrobat SDK kit that can be used without the need for Acrobat.  One of the things that is not present in the SDK of PDFLibrary is the API of Acrobat forms you mention.
